Who are the talented voice actors behind the beloved animated film, Moana?

Aulii Cravalho, Dwayne Johnson, Rachel House, Temuera Morrison, Jemaine Clement, and Nicole Scherzinger are the incredible voice actors who bring the characters of Moana to life. Each actor lends their unique talent and vocal range to create a vibrant and captivating cast, perfectly embodying the spirit of the film's Polynesian setting and its themes of adventure, self-discovery, and cultural heritage.

Personal Details and Bio Data of Aulii Cravalho, the voice of Moana:

Name Aulii Cravalho
Birthdate November 22, 2000
Birthplace Kohala, Hawaii
Occupation Actress, singer
Known for Moana, Rise, Angry Birds 2

Question 1: Who are the voice actors behind the main characters in Moana?

The talented voice cast of Moana includes Auli'i Cravalho as the titular character, Dwayne Johnson as Maui, Rachel House as Tala, Temuera Morrison as Tui, Jemaine Clement as Tamatoa, and Nicole Scherzinger as Sina.

Question 2: Were the voice actors chosen specifically for their cultural backgrounds?

Yes, the filmmakers made a conscious effort to cast actors of Polynesian descent to ensure authenticity and cultural sensitivity in the portrayal of the characters and the film's Polynesian setting.
